Our analysis found Community College of Denver to be the most popular school for legal support services students who want to pursue an online associate degree in the Rocky Mountains Region . CCD is a medium-sized public school located in the city of Denver.

About 73% of the students majoring in legal support at the school are women while 27% are male.
